What is the average hourly rate for a {{keyword}} in Lansing?

Hourly rates vary based on factors like experience, job complexity, and location. In Lansing, rates typically range from $50 to $100 per hour, but it's best to request detailed estimates from several electricians to get an accurate cost for your specific project.

Are electricians in Lansing able to install EV charging stations?

Many electricians in Lansing are qualified to install electric vehicle charging stations. They can assess your electrical capacity, install the necessary wiring and outlets, and ensure the setup meets all safety requirements. Confirm with local contractors about their EV installation services.

Do I need a permit for electrical work in Lansing?

Most electrical projects, especially major installations or renovations, require a permit from the local authority. A professional electrician in Lansing will typically handle the permitting process, ensuring that all work is inspected and compliant with local regulations.
